Ben-Gvir Demands Terrorist Execution, Cites Hanging

By מערכת חמ״לUpdated 1 hour ago
Translated & summarized from Hamal by baba
The story · English

National Security Minister Itamar Ben-Gvir stated that if a terrorist is not eliminated, "his place is on the gallows." The minister's remarks were made in response to an unspecified incident involving a terrorist.

Ben-Gvir's comments, made in Hebrew, express a strong stance on dealing with terrorists, advocating for the death penalty. The statement implies a call for decisive action against individuals deemed terrorists.

While the specific context of the terrorist in question is not detailed in the provided text, Ben-Gvir's pronouncement underscores his hardline approach to security matters. The minister has previously advocated for stricter measures against those involved in terrorism.
